JOB SUMMARY for Account Management Manager

Manages and develops sales plans for a team of account managers.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ES for Account Management Manager

Focuses on the long-term planning and selling of a variety of products, services, and/or solutions across multiple lines of business for a defined group of existing clients. Ensures that account managers meet the ongoing needs of clients and prospects while accomplishing individual revenue goals. May be personally responsible for managing major accounts. May set sales targets or quotas. May make suggestions for product improvements or expanding sales channels.

Proficiency Levels and Behavioural Indicators
Salary.com identifies five increasing levels of proficiency for each skill/competency. Some jobs require only a relatively low level of proficiency in each skill/competency, while other jobs will require a more advanced level of proficiency in the same skill/competency. These levels rate the degree of proficiency (skill level, expertise) we expect the incumbent to perform in the given skill/competency for the given job. Note that we intentionally do not associate timeframes or years of experience in performing the skill/competency because that can be misleading. Proficiency levels identify what the incumbent knows and can do rather than how long they have been doing it. Also, note that the proficiency levels are cumulative, e.g., a level 4 proficiency implies the ability to perform all the behaviors at the lower levels.
